Index: Source/platform/graphics/paint/FixedPositionContainerDisplayItem.h |
diff --git a/Source/platform/graphics/paint/FixedPositionContainerDisplayItem.h b/Source/platform/graphics/paint/FixedPositionContainerDisplayItem.h |
index 8b1a948537c3e05cb1c7b83f9c2642ea8f1bfb1a..dfa448d4e2d83b52bb7171819b6ae2f8aaddf99f 100644 |
--- a/Source/platform/graphics/paint/FixedPositionContainerDisplayItem.h |
+++ b/Source/platform/graphics/paint/FixedPositionContainerDisplayItem.h |
@@ -7,40 +7,21 @@ |
#include "platform/geometry/LayoutSize.h" |
#include "platform/graphics/paint/DisplayItem.h" |
-#include "wtf/FastAllocBase.h" |
#include "wtf/PassOwnPtr.h" |
namespace blink { |
class PLATFORM_EXPORT BeginFixedPositionContainerDisplayItem : public PairedBeginDisplayItem { |
- WTF_MAKE_FAST_ALLOCATED(BeginFixedPositionContainerDisplayItem); |
public: |
- static PassOwnPtr<BeginFixedPositionContainerDisplayItem> create(const DisplayItemClientWrapper& client) |
- { |
- return adoptPtr(new BeginFixedPositionContainerDisplayItem(client)); |
- } |
- |
- BeginFixedPositionContainerDisplayItem(const DisplayItemClientWrapper& client) |
- : PairedBeginDisplayItem(client, BeginFixedPositionContainer) |
- { |
- } |
+ BeginFixedPositionContainerDisplayItem(const DisplayItemClientWrapper& client) : PairedBeginDisplayItem(client, BeginFixedPositionContainer) { } |
virtual void replay(GraphicsContext&) override final { } |
virtual void appendToWebDisplayItemList(WebDisplayItemList*) const override final; |
}; |
class PLATFORM_EXPORT EndFixedPositionContainerDisplayItem : public PairedEndDisplayItem { |
- WTF_MAKE_FAST_ALLOCATED(EndFixedPositionContainerDisplayItem); |
public: |
- static PassOwnPtr<EndFixedPositionContainerDisplayItem> create(const DisplayItemClientWrapper& client) |
- { |
- return adoptPtr(new EndFixedPositionContainerDisplayItem(client)); |
- } |
- |
- EndFixedPositionContainerDisplayItem(const DisplayItemClientWrapper& client) |
- : PairedEndDisplayItem(client, EndFixedPositionContainer) |
- { |
- } |
+ EndFixedPositionContainerDisplayItem(const DisplayItemClientWrapper& client) : PairedEndDisplayItem(client, EndFixedPositionContainer) { } |
virtual void replay(GraphicsContext&) override final { } |
virtual void appendToWebDisplayItemList(WebDisplayItemList*) const override final; |